- [ ] Step 7: Archive cold storage buckets (Glacierline tier). Confirm both ceremony witnesses are present, verify bucket manifests match the Oxbow ledger, then seal the archive key shares. Plugin authors may observe but not handle shares. Once sealed, the archive index itself is encrypted and can only be reopened with the passphrase below.

vault phrase of badup-hahig = tamael-aldael-kelmir-istael-fenok-istwyn-tamius-jorath-oliion

Quick test-plan note for the Bramblewood firmware channel: before we ship 4.2 to the beta ring, we want one full update-then-rollback loop on at least three lab units, plus a simulated mid-flash power cut on one of them. If the watchdog recovers cleanly, we're green. Timing-wise, the manifest cache takes about ten minutes to settle, so don't panic if devices lag. All pushes to the beta ring go through the staging gateway, which wants an Authorization header — use the bearer token right below this note.

portal login ticket: eyJhbGciOiJIUzI1NiIsInR5cCI6IkpXVCJ9.eyJzdWIiOiIMjvRAf3PEFIn0.nuv9gjixLtnr

## Who to ping about GiftNote

Welcome aboard! GiftNote is our donation-receipt mailer for the Larchfield Fund. Template tweaks go to the comms folks; delivery failures and bounce weirdness go to the platform crew. Don't push template changes on Fridays — receipts batch over the weekend. For anything GiftNote-related, start with the address below.

billing contact of kaweg-tajeg = drudor.lamion.oliath@torvalabs.test

Memo to the incoming director — Capacity at the Threlfall plant. Quick backgrounder before you start: we've been running Threlfall at about 85% for two quarters, and the Ostermark order book says that won't hold. Options on the table are a third shift, a line extension, or shifting overflow to the Quenby site. Ops leans toward the shift; finance prefers Quenby. You'll want to weigh in early. The confidential context sits just below.

confidential, yahip-hagug: Gorixax Logistics plans to lower the Ulaael list price by 26.6 percent in October. The pricing group signed off on a budget of $199.9 million for Project Holix. The renewal with Kasdorox Systems closes at $137.5 million a year, 8.2 percent above the last contract. Project Lamion slips by a full year because of the audit delay.